So lets start with the basics and what the elements are. So, there are five elements, fire, earth, water, air, and spirit/ aether. These all line up with the points of pentagram.
K, so here is some basic information on each.
Spirit- To Become Perfected, the element of center, of self.
Water- To Dare ,west, autumn,
In astrology
Scorpio (my sun sign)
Pisces
Cancer
Fire- To Will, south, summer
In astrology
Aries
Sagittarius
Leo
Earth- To Learn, north, winter
In astrology
Capricorn
Taurus
Virgo
Air- To Keep Silent, east, spring,
In astrology
Aquarius
Gemini
Libra
So, you want to connect with the elements. Know this is a process that will take weeks so be prepared. Now, each element is going to take at least 3 days to a week to get to know. What you need to do for which ever element you want to connect to, you will meditate and come to know what the element is to you. Build up a connection, such as you would do for a friend, the more you meditate with it the better of a reception you will get.
So say you want to try to connect with fire first, sit next to an open flame, just watching it and feeling its heat. Meditate with the fire and find what it means to you get to know the fire and let the fire know you. For water, meditate with a bowl of water. Feel it in your hands and do the same as you did with the fire. Build up a stable connection. Earth you can get a hand full of dirt or meditate outside without shoes. for air its best to go outside on a few windy days to meditate and focus on the feel with your eyes closed.
"How do I know when I know the elements?"
Well, it depends on the person, it could just be you know what they mean to you. Or they could have a nice friendly feeling when your around them. Maybe you begin to feel their energy clear as day. It should just be easier to call on then and know them.
